Seven Layer Salad
 
Source: dLife

Fresh vegetable and pasta salad with a buttermilk and feta dressing.

Nutrition Facts

Makes 8 servings
Amount Per Serving
Calories 164.6
Total Carbs 21.5 g
Dietary Fiber 2 g
Sugars 4.8 g
Total Fat 4.7 g
Saturated Fat 2.7 g
Unsaturated Fat 2 g
Potassium 289.9 mg
Protein 9.7 g
Sodium 357.7 mg
Dietary Exchanges
1/2 Fat, 1 Starch, 1/2 Vegetable

Ingredients
0.5 cup fat free sour cream
0.5 cup low fat buttermilk
0.5 cup crumbled feta cheese
1 tsp sugar
0.25 tsp dried dill weed
0.5 tsp ground basil leaves
0.12 tsp white pepper
9 oz spinach tortellini
6 cup fresh chopped spinach (or romaine lettuce)
0.5 lb fresh mushroom slices
2 roma tomatoes , chopped
4 fresh green onions , chopped
2.5 oz Canadian bacon , pan-cooked and cut into pieces


Directions
1 Blend the sour cream, buttermilk, feta cheese, sugar, dill weed, basil, and pepper in a food processor until it is smooth.
2 Cook the tortellini according to the package instructions omitting any oil and salt, and drain and rinse in cold water.
3 In a 3-quart oblong dish, layer the spinach leaves, tortellini, mushrooms, tomatoes, and green onions. Pour dressing over the salad, spreading to cover. Don't toss. Sprinkle with the bacon, cover, and chill at least 2 hours to blend the flavors.
